Why 15 horsepower: an analysis of the possibilities

The popularity of the 15 hp category is due not to marketing tricks, but to the physics of water movement. For a standard two- or three-seater PVC boat with an inflatable floor (NDNDB) or hard floorboard, this power is enough to enter planing mode with two passengers and cargo. Speed. in this mode is usually from 25 to 35 km / h, depending on the screw and shape of the body.

It is important to understand that 15 hp engine. Exceeding the recommended power can cause the transom to deform or even break the cylinders at high speed due to hydrodynamic loads. So always check the markings on your boat's transom before buying.

⚠️ Attention: Installing a motor with a power above the boat specified in the data sheet (for example, 20 hp on a boat with a limit of 15 hp) will cancel the PVC warranty and may be regarded by the GIMS inspection as a violation of the rules for the operation of small vessels.

On the other hand, the 15 horse power reserve allows a wider range of propellers to be used, choosing the optimal step for fishing or cruising, making the unit a versatile soldier who will not stall when turning abruptly and easily drags the boat against the current.

Two-stroke or four-stroke: the eternal dilemma of a water motor

When choosing a power unit, everyone faces the question of the type of work cycle. Two-stroke engines (2Ts) are traditionally lighter than their four-stroke counterparts and cheaper to maintain, and operate on a mixture of gasoline and oil, which makes transportation easier but creates more noise and vibration.

In turn, four-stroke (4T) are quieter, fuel efficient and do not require oil mixture preparation. However, their weight is often critical for light inflatable boats. The difference in weight between 2T and 4T of equal power can reach 10-15 kg, which significantly affects driving performance and stability.

Let’s look at the key differences in the table to structure the information:

Parameter two-stroke (2T) four-stroke (4T)
Weight (approximate) 34-38 kg 45-52 kg
Fuel consumption High (up to 6 l/h) Low (up to 3.5 l/h)
Noise High. Low.
Service Simple, butter mixing Harder, changing the oil in the crankcase.

If you plan long trips across large bodies of water, where every liter of fuel counts, a four-stroke will be more profitable, but for short trips to fishing with friends, where speed of assembly and ease of movement of the boat along the shore are important, a two-stroke is often more practical.

Transportation and weight: critical factors for PVC

Motor weight is not just a number in the passport, it is a factor that affects the logistics of the entire trip. 15 hp engine. In two-stroke versions, it weighs about 35 kg, which is already the limit of comfort for one person to carry over long distances. Four-stroke analogues can weigh more than 45 kg, which requires either a strong back or a wheelbarrow.

In inflatable boats, the center of gravity is also very important, and a heavy motor attached to a transom can be very stern-like, especially if there's only one person in the boat, which increases water resistance and slows down speed, and in these cases, you sometimes have to use extra inflatable tubes or outriggers to stabilize.

When transporting in the trunk of a car, it is important to consider not only weight, but also dimensions. Some models have a compact leg, others are cumbersome lower unit. Always try on the engine to your boat before buying, if possible.

Maintenance and engine life

Resource of the modern outboard Two-stroke models require regular cleaning of the carburetor and candles, and the use of quality oil with the right mixing ratio, neglecting these rules leads to the coking of the piston group.

Four-stroke engines are more autonomous, but require a change in engine oil every 50-100 hours, and you also need to monitor the state of the water pump, which is the heart of the cooling system, overheating is the main enemy of any power plant, regardless of tact.

It's important to use only the fuels that the manufacturer recommends. TC-W3For four-strokes, viscosity-appropriate oil for outboard motors. The use of automotive oils in outboard motors (especially 2T) is unacceptable, as they form a deposit and do not burn completely.

Routinely flushing your cooling system with fresh water after every exit into salt water or muddy pond will significantly extend your engine's life. Corrosion is a silent killer that can disable expensive knots in just one season.

Screws and settings: how to squeeze the maximum

Even the most powerful engine will not show its capabilities with the wrong screw. The standard aluminum screw that comes with the kit is often a compromise solution. For heavy boats or full load, it makes sense to purchase a screw with a reduced pitch to get faster on plane.

For high-speed walks with a low load, you can put a screw with an increased pitch, but it is important to prevent the engine from operating in the β€œsubject” mode of revs. Optimal speeds They are usually in the range of 4500-5500 rpm at full gas.

The screw material also matters. Aluminum is cheap and easy to repair (handled with a hammer), but quickly loses geometry when impacted. Stainless steel is stronger and more efficient, but when hit by a stone can transfer the load to lower unit, which can be fraught with expensive repairs.

⚠️ Attention: If after the replacement of the screw the engine stopped developing full speed or, conversely, "spinning", it is urgent to replace the screw with a model with a different step.

Which gasoline is best used for a two-stroke engine 15 hp?

Use AI-92 or AI-95 gasoline (depending on manual recommendations, more often AI-92) with a shelf life of no more than 30 days. Old gasoline loses its octane number and forms resins that clog the carburetor.

Do I need to run a new engine?

Yes, it's mandatory for any new engine, which is typically 10 hours of operation in different modes (mainly partial throttle) that allows the parts to get lost, and ignoring the break-in reduces the life of the engine.

Why does the 15 HP engine not reach full speed?

There may be several reasons: overgrown bottom of the boat (shells, algae), improperly selected propeller, damaged impeller pump or problems with the fuel supply system.
